Truck Toll Croatia: The HAC System

Croatia is an important transit country on the route to Southeast Europe and Greece. Motorway tolls are distance-based, collected at toll plazas – classic ticket-and-barrier, with electronic ENC devices as an alternative.

The toll system: HAC

The main Croatian motorway operator is HAC (Hrvatske autoceste), with BINA Istra operating the A9/A10 in Istria. The system uses toll plazas (closed system): ticket on entry, payment on exit. Electronic ENC devices are available as an alternative. Charging is in euros.

Which roads are tolled?

  • Motorways (A-roads) – the entire network
  • Some expressways with special rates

National roads are toll-free. For transit traffic towards the Balkans, the A1 (Zagreb–Split) and A3 (towards Serbia) are most relevant.

Rate structure: axle count

The rate depends on the vehicle category:

Axles Factor
2 axles 1.0
3 axles 1.5
4 axles 2.0
5+ axles 2.4

The base rate on motorways is €0.092/km. A 40-tonne articulated lorry with 5 axles therefore pays around €0.22/km – Croatia is one of the cheaper toll countries in Europe.
